You have a Microsoft Exchange Online tenant that contains a public folder named PF1.

You need to ensure that email sent to [email protected] is posted to F1.

What should you do?

  • A. Create a shared mailbox.
  • B. Mail-enable the public folder.
  • C. Create a public folder mailbox.
  • D. Create a mail flow rule.
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: B 🗳️
